东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x

上传人:b****8 文档编号:9374003 上传时间:2023-02-04 格式:DOCX 页数:7 大小:16.27KB
下载 相关 举报
东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x_第1页
第1页 / 共7页
东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x_第2页
第2页 / 共7页
东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x_第3页
第3页 / 共7页
东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x_第4页
第4页 / 共7页
东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x_第5页
第5页 / 共7页
点击查看更多>>
下载资源
资源描述

东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x

《东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x》由会员分享,可在线阅读,更多相关《东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x(7页珍藏版)》请在冰豆网上搜索。

东北大学 15春学期《数据结构Ⅱ》在线作业及满分答案.docx

东北大学15春学期《数据结构Ⅱ》在线作业及满分答案

东北大学15春学期《数据结构Ⅱ》在线作业及满分答案

一、单选题(共20道试题,共100分。

1.   

在头指针为head且表长大于1的单循环链表中,指针p指向表中某个结点,若p->next->next=

  head,则

   

A.  p指向头结点           

B.  p指向尾结点 

    

C.  p的直接后继是头结点    

D.  P的直接后继是尾结点

正确答案:

D

2.   

对于顺序存储的线性表,访问结点和增加、删除结点的时间复杂度为

A.O(n)  O(n)            

B.  O(n)  O

(1)     

C. 

O

(1)  O(n)              

D. 

O

(1)O

(1)

正确答案:

C

3.   

链栈与顺序栈相比,比较明显的优点是

A. 

插入操作更加方便          

B. 

删除操作更加方便

C. 

不会出现下溢的情况       

D. 

不会出现上溢的情况

正确答案:

D

4.   

文件中,主关键字能唯一标识

   

A.一个记录      

B.  一组记录 

   

C.  一个类型              

D. 

一个文件

正确答案:

A

5.   

数据元素及其关系在计算机存储器内的表示,称为数据的

   

A.逻辑结构           

B.存储结构 

  

C. 

线性结构            

D. 

非线性结构

正确答案:

B

6.   

一棵左子树为空的二叉树在先序线索化后,其中空的链域的个数是

  

A.  不确定               

B.0

C.1

D.2

正确答案:

D

7.   

下述哪一条是顺序存储结构的优点

A. 

存储密度大            

B. 

插入运算方便  

C. 

删除运算方便          

D. 

可方便地用于各种逻辑结构的存储表示

正确答案:

A

8.  

  

连通网的最小生成树是其所有生成树中

   

A.  顶点集最小的生成树          

B.  边集最小的生成树 

  

C. 

顶点权值之和最小的生成树      

D.  边的权值之和最小的生成树

正确答案:

D

9.   

在图采用邻接表存储时,求最小生成树的Prim算法的时间复杂度为

A. 

  O(n)                    

B. 

  O(n+e)     

C. 

O(n2)                  

D. 

O(n3)

正确答案:

B

10.   

下列排序算法中,时间复杂度不受数据初始状态影响,恒为0(nlog2n)的是

A. 

堆排序                

B. 

冒泡排序   

C. 

直接选择排序            

D. 

快速排序

正确答案:

A

11.   

在关键字序列(12,23,34,45,56,67,78,89,91)中二分查找关键字为45、89和12的结点时,所需进行的比较次数分别为

   

A.  4,4,3                

B.  4,3,3 

   

C. 

3,4,4                

D.  .3,3,4

正确答案:

B

12.   

带行表的三元组表是稀疏矩阵的一种

   

A.  顺序存储结构             

B.链式存储结构 

   

C. 

索引存储结构            

D. 

散列存储结构

正确答案:

A

13.   

已知一组关键字为{25,48,36,72,79,82,23,40,16,35},其中每相邻两个为有序子序列。

对这些子序列进行一趟两两归并的结果是

A. 

.{25,36,48,72,23,40,79,82,16,35}

B. 

.{25,36,48,72,16,23,40,79,82,35}

C. 

.{25,36,48,72,16,23,35,40,79,82}

D. 

.{16,23,25,35,36,40,48,72,79,82}

正确答案:

D

14.   

对于哈希函数H(key)=key%13,被称为同义词的关键字是

   

A.  35和41                

B.  23和39 

  

C.  15和44               

D.  25和51

正确答案:

D

15.   

已知含6个顶点(v0,v1,v2,v3,v4,v5)的无向图的邻接矩阵如图所示,则从顶点v0出发进行深度优先遍历可能得到的顶点访问序列为

   

A..(v0,v1,v2,v5,v4,v3) 

  

B. 

(v0,v1,v2,v3,v4,v5)

  

C. 

  (v0,v1,v5,v2,v3,v4)

   

D. 

.(v0,v1,v4,v5,v2,v3)

正确答案:

B

16.   

在平衡二叉树中插入一个结点后引起了不平衡,设最低(最接近于叶子)的不平衡点是A,并已知A的左、右孩子的平衡因子分别为-1和0,则应进行的平衡旋转是

    

A.  LL型                

B.LR型     

    

C. 

RL型                 

D.  RR型

正确答案:

B

17.   

对二叉树从1开始进行连续编号,要求每个结点的编号大于其左右孩子的编号,同一个结点的左右孩子中,其左孩子的编号小于其右孩子的编号,则可采用遍历方式是

    

A.  先序                    

B.  中序     

    

C.  后序                    

D.  从根开始的层次遍历

正确答案:

C

18.   

如果在数据结构中每个数据元素只可能有一个直接前驱,但可以有多个直接后继,则该结构是

    

A.  栈                      

B.  队列 

    

C. 

树                      

D. 

正确答案:

C

19.   

栈是一种操作受限的线性结构,其操作的主要特征是

A. 

先进先出              

B. 

后进先出

C. 

进优于出           

D. 

出优于进

正确答案:

B

20.   

在按层次遍历二叉树的算法中,需要借助的辅助数据结构是

   

A.  队列                

B.  栈 

   

C.  线性表              

D.  

  有序表

正确答案:

A

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 解决方案 > 学习计划

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1